Birmingham City Centre

Birmingham City Centre blends historic charm with modern energy in the heart of England's second city. Victorian architecture stands alongside sleek glass towers, creating a dynamic skyline. Explore the iconic Bullring shopping centre or admire masterpieces at the Birmingham Museum & Art Gallery. The vibrant cultural scene includes the historic Hippodrome theatre and Symphony Hall. The area hums with activity day and night. Wander through the picturesque canals that weave through the district. Diverse dining options range from street food to fine restaurants reflecting the city's multicultural heritage. Three train stations and convenient tram stops make getting around effortless.

Jewellery Quarter

Birmingham's Jewellery Quarter sparkles with history and creativity in a compact, walkable setting. Over 200 listed buildings dating to the 18th century showcase Britain's jewelry-making heritage. Former factories now house galleries and design studios alongside traditional goldsmiths still practising their craft. The Museum of the Jewellery Quarter and Pen Museum tell fascinating stories of local craftsmanship. Red brick Victorian buildings with ornate ironwork line cobblestone streets that buzz with artisan energy. St. Paul's Church anchors the Georgian heart of this creative enclave. Boutique shops offer everything from bespoke jewellery to contemporary art. The quarter quiets after sunset when workshops close and local pubs welcome area residents.

Digbeth

Birmingham's Digbeth district has transformed from industrial powerhouse to creative hotspot. Former warehouses now house galleries, studios, and hip venues like the Custard Factory where travellers discover street art and independent businesses. The red-brick Victorian buildings provide a historic backdrop for this artistic revival. The area pulses with energy at music venues, craft breweries, and the popular Digbeth Dining Club street food market. You'll find vintage shops, record stores, and weekend markets selling handmade goods. Just a short walk from Birmingham's city centre, Digbeth offers an authentic slice of the city's creative soul.

Best time to go to Birmingham

Birmingham (and vicinity) boasts a year-around average temperature of 9.4ยฐC, peaking at 15.8ยฐC in July, its warmest month, and dipping to an average low of 3.6ยฐC in January, the coolest. Rainfall averages at 63.2mm annually, with November seeing the heaviest showers and June being the driest month.

What is there to see in Birmingham?
Known for its theatres, cultural venues include The Alexandra Theatre, Birmingham Hippodrome and Birmingham Town Hall. Families come for attractions such as Thinktank Birmingham Science Museum, National SEA LIFE Centre and LEGOLANDยฎ Discovery Centre. Landmarks like St Martins in the Bull Ring, Birmingham Cathedral and Victoria Square might be worth a visit. Take a look at what more there is to see and do in Expedia's Birmingham guide.
